Abstract
Television in China is at a cross-roads where past and future meet. Delphi and cross-impact analytic methods are used in this paper to outline interactive patterns between television and social-economic factors that possibly suggest future directions.

Lin Sun
Lin Sun, Ph.D. in telecommunications, Michigan State University, received his Masters degree in communications from the University of Hawaii, and his BA from the Beijing Broadcasting Institute. He was a TV news reporter and producer at China Central Television (CCTV) before going to the US.
